The local market in Mumbai has recently experienced unexpected developments that have captured the attention of both residents and business owners. The municipal authorities have implemented a new policy aimed at enhancing the market’s infrastructure, focusing on increased safety and convenience for everyone involved.

Key Features of the New Policy

  • Stall Placements: New regulations to organize vendor stalls more efficiently.
  • Waste Management: Improved systems to maintain cleanliness throughout the market.
  • Operating Hours: Adjusted timings to reduce congestion.

These measures are designed to reduce overcrowding and promote healthier business practices within the bustling market environment.

Reactions from Market Vendors

The response from vendors has been mixed:

  1. Some vendors view the reforms as a positive step toward modernization.
  2. Others are concerned about the financial costs associated with adapting to the new regulations.

Government Support & Economic Impact

In light of these concerns, the local government has committed to providing:

  • Financial aid for small vendors.
  • Training programs to help vendors transition smoothly.

Experts believe that these support measures can potentially boost the local economy and create a more enjoyable shopping atmosphere.

Broader Implications

These changes arrive at a time when the demand for improved urban spaces in Mumbai is growing rapidly. As the city continues to expand in population, these reforms may serve as a model for other markets across India, promoting sustainable urban development.
